2018 Witnessed considerable achievements for the Centre in research, community involvement and teaching. In our first year working in collaboration with researchers in Leicester and beyond we have achieved a number of funding awards, publications and developed community interventions.
We have successfully established an expert steering committee, bringing together academic expertise, clinical knowledge and community perspectives to drive our Centre’s research agenda and ensure our work meets a local need. Furthermore, established in 2018 is the Community Partners Panel and Research Volunteers register. We have a panel of 16 members from different backgrounds, who represent the voice of not only themselves but a large number of community organisations that they are involved with. Thereby the work of centre is informed by the community and learning and outcomes can be disseminated widely. The Research Volunteers Register is a database of individuals who wish to be involved in research that addresses health inequalities, this resource continues to grow…
